Eske Kath

Eske Kath creates unreal, synthetic pictorial spaces which defy the laws of geometry.

The post-apocalyptic landscapes on Kath’s canvases are twisted spaces with free-floating houses, plants and trees, often against a psychedelically bright background. They convey an unsettling yet strangely appealing atmosphere, visualizing the fundamental uncertainty that has become a basic human condition in a time of climate change and catastrophes.

Eske Kath, born 1975 in Christiansfeld, Denmark, lives and works in Copenhagen. He has been collaborating with BORCH Editions since 1999.
